About

I Jáuregui is a scholar working on Immunology and Allergy, Physiology and Rheumatology. According to data from OpenAlex, I Jáuregui has authored 98 papers receiving a total of 2.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 43 papers in Immunology and Allergy, 37 papers in Physiology and 29 papers in Rheumatology. Recurrent topics in I Jáuregui's work include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(37 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(36 papers) and Urticaria and Related Conditions (27 papers). I Jáuregui is often cited by papers focused on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(37 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(36 papers) and Urticaria and Related Conditions (27 papers). I Jáuregui coll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Germany and Argentina. I Jáuregui's co-authors include Marta Ferrer, J. Sastre, Joaquim Mullol, Joan Bartra, Ignacio Dávila, A del Cuvillo, J Montoro, I. Antépara, Antonio Valero and Sara Guillén-Aguinaga and has published in prestigious journals such as Thorax, British Journal of Dermatology and Allergy.
